Adjustable depth safety cutter

1. An adjustable depth safety cutter for boxes comprising:
- an elongated body having a front end portion with a cutting face, an intermediate handle section and a rear end portion;
a blade holding slide mounted for linear movement in the body, the slide having a knife holding head which extends and retracts through an opening in the cutting face and a resilient member attached to the slide which tends to keep the knife holding head retracted with respect to the cutting face;
a manually operated slide button on the blade holding slide which extends from a slide opening in the intermediate handle section and includes a first locking mechanism which selectively locks the slide in a desired locked position and has an unlocked position which allows the slide to move linearly;
a second locking button which engages the slide in a holding position which holds the slide in a plurality of extended positions of the knife holding head with respect to the cutting face and a release position which releases the slide for retraction; and
a depressible spring loaded knife guard extending from an opening in the cutting face in front of the knife holding head.

Abstract
An improved carton cutter has an incrementally extendable fully retractable first cutting blade with a depressible safety guard at its front end. A strap cutting second blade is fixed at a hooked rear end of the cutter. A ratchet mechanism provides audible evidence of the amount of blade extension and a pointer shows the position of the front blade. The front blade is mounted on a lockable slide. Both blades are easily removable without disassembly and precisely positioned without noticeable play.

8. An adjustable depth safety cutter for boxes comprising:
-
an elongated body having a front end portion with a cutting face, an intermediate handle section and a rear end portion; a blade holding slide mounted for linear movement with respect to the body, the slide having a knife holding head which extends and retracts through an opening in the cutting face and a resilient member attached to the slide which tends to keep the knife holding head retracted with respect to the cutting face; a manually operated slide button on the blade holding slide which extends from a slide opening in the intermediate handle section; a second locking button which engages the slide in a holding position which holds the slide in any of a plurality of extended positions of the knife holding head with respect to the cutting face, said locking button having a release position which releases the slide for retraction; and a depressible spring loaded knife guard extending from an opening in the cutting face in front of the knife holding head. - View Dependent Claims (9, 10, 11,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18, 19)

20. An adjustable depth safety cutter for boxes comprising:
-
an elongated body having a front end portion with a cutting face, an intermediate handle section and a rear end portion; a blade holding slide which is mounted for linear movement with respect to the body, said slide having a knife holding head which is selectively movable to at least partially extend from the cutting face at the front end portion of the body; and at least one slidable edge guide which is slidingly mounted at the front end portion of the elongated body for movement between a first position in which the guide is not extended from the cutting face and a second position in which the guide has a portion extended beyond the cutting face thereby providing a guide for lateral positioning of the knife holding head with respect to an edge of a box. - View Dependent Claims (21, 22, 23, 24, 25)
